Fab Lab Boot Camp

5:30 PM - 7:30 PM 17th Oct 2018

United States

This workshop is a sampler of the Fab Lab equipment to get your hands on with the 3D Printers, Laser Cutters, Vinyl Cutter and software design all in one day! Participants will be assisted to create something on each piece of equipment, be provided with a safety overview and leave with a basic understanding of machine use and applications.

Fab Lab Bootcamp is a great way to get comfortable in the Fab Lab and see if you’d like to sign up and learn more about a particular piece of equipment.

No prior software or training required. Each participant will walk away with something lasered, 3D printed and at least one vinyl design, ready to hang.

The Fab Lab is a place where students can build science, technology, engineering and math skills through hands on learning. Participanting in Fab Lab activities allow students to explore and experiment with digital fabrication technology including 3D Printers, Laser Cutters, and Vinyl Cutters.
